It was clear that US Secretary of State Hillary Clinton didn't want to be reminded of her 63rd birthday on Tuesday.
When Austrian Foreign Minister Michael Spindelegger told a small group of reporters during a Tuesday meeting with Clinton that it was her birthday, she interrupted saying: "Oh dear!"
As the diplomats and journalists burst into laughter, Spindelegger said: "25th birthday!"
Clinton responded saying: "It coincides with National Austria Day. I'm very excited about that!"
There was more laughter — and then both answered questions about another event being marked on Tuesday, the 10th anniversary of the first UN Security Council resolution calling for women to have decision-making positions at every level of peacemaking and peacebuilding.
Clinton and Spindelegger addressed the ministerial meeting of the council.
